THE PITFALLS OF THE NUMISMATIC EVIDENCE. THE AUXILIARY FORT OF ARCOBADARA (ILIŞUA, BISTRIŢA-NĂSĂUD COUNTY, ROMANIA)

In the light of the publication of the numismatic monograph from the site of Arcobadara (Ilişua) in Roman Dacia (Romania), the present work is pointing out the pitfalls that the scholar may have to face when dealing with old and non-professional publication of artefacts.Downloads
